River Metals Recycling, LLC (RMR) is a wholly owned venture of Cincinnati-based, The David J. Joseph Company (DJJ), one of the USA’s largest scrap metal companies. Our parent company’s rich history began in 1885. We possess a wealth of experience and an entrepreneurial spirit that is vital to success in the scrap recycling industry. DJJ is also part of Nucor Corporation’s family of companies. Head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, Nucor is the leading purchaser of ferrous scrap and the largest recycler in North America. RMR was formed in 1998 by combining the Klempner Brothers yard, River City Baling, and River City Shredding (all in Louisville, KY) with DJJ’s Henderson, KY and Newport, KY yards. Today, we operate 19 recycling facilities in 5 states with a focused presence in the Louisville, Kentucky and Cincinnati, Ohio regions.
